Before you book

How to choose a motorcycle repair shop in Birmingham

Choosing the right motorcycle repair shop can make all the difference in your riding experience. Here are some tips to help you make the best choice.

Consider the shop's reputation

Look for shops with strong customer reviews and a history of quality service. Word of mouth and online ratings can provide valuable insights.

Evaluate the range of services

Ensure the shop offers the specific services you need, from general maintenance to specialized repairs. A full-service shop can be more convenient.

Check pricing and transparency

Transparent pricing and clear communication about costs are essential. Avoid shops that are vague about their rates or unwilling to provide estimates.

What it costs

What motorcycle repair costs in Birmingham

Motorcycle repair costs can vary widely based on the type of service and the shop's pricing structure. Here's a general overview of what to expect in Birmingham.

Basic MaintenanceRoutine services like oil changes and brake inspections typically range from $50 to $150.
Intermediate RepairsServices such as tire replacements and chain adjustments usually cost between $100 and $300.
Advanced RepairsMore complex tasks like engine rebuilds or electrical work can range from $300 to $800.
Custom ModificationsFor custom work, prices can vary significantly, often starting at $500 and going upwards based on complexity.
